Health Watch issued Monday for metro Tucson
TUCSON – Due to elevated levels of air pollution of ground-level ozone, Pima County Department of Environmental Quality (PDEQ) has issued a “Health Watch” for Monday in the Tucson metropolitan area.
PDEQ says people who are sensitive to air pollution may experience shortness of breath, coughing, throat irritation, wheezing, and breathing discomfort.
